Do Cabinets Increase a Home’s Resale Value (Cabinet ROI)?
A 5‑year‑old kitchen with dated cabinets can cost you up to 10 % of the home’s asking price, while a modest cabinet upgrade typically adds $560‑$960 in value for every $800‑$1,200 spent on complementary updates. You’ll see refacing delivering 60‑75 % ROI, often hitting 75‑96 % when premium materials match seasonal trends. Full replacement costs $15‑$25 K but yields 80‑90 % ROI, yet the 3‑5‑day install window of refacing beats the 8‑12‑week replacement timeline. Cabinet ergonomics—adjustable heights, pull‑out drawers, and soft‑close hinges—boost buyer appeal, especially in markets where functional layouts outrank aesthetics. Data shows mid‑range homes recoup 70‑113 % of spend under $30 K, while high‑end markets see diminishing returns beyond mid‑range spending. What ROI Do Kitchen Cabinet Remodels Deliver?
Cabinet refacing alone can net 75‑96 % ROI, and when the existing units are in good shape that figure climbs to about 85 %. In minor kitchen remodels that include cabinet updates, the national average ROI hits 113 %, with costs around $28,458 returning $32,141. Regional trends show Pacific homeowners reaching 129 % ROI, while West North Central lags at 94.5 %. How Do Garage Cabinets Affect Buyer Perception (Cabinet ROI)?
When buyers step into a garage that’s already organized with built‑in cabinets, they instantly perceive a well‑maintained home and are more likely to trust the property’s overall condition. Data shows that 80 % of agents say clutter reduces offers, while sleek cabinets boost buyer perception and confidence. Built‑in units maximize vertical space, making the garage appear larger and more versatile, which translates to higher perceived storage functionality. This visual order signals intentional maintenance, differentiating the home in competitive markets where garage storage ranks among the top 13 desired features. Buyers envision practical uses—workshops, gear storage, hobby zones—enhancing buyer confidence and accelerating sales. Consequently, garage cabinets act as a low‑cost, high‑impact upgrade that improves market competitiveness. Do Custom Cabinets Fetch Higher Offers Than Stock (Cabinet ROI)?
Buyers already value organized garage space, and the next logical step is the kitchen—where the majority of resale perception hinges. You’ll see that custom ROI outpaces stock ROI by a clear margin. Stock cabinets cost $60–$200 per linear foot, last about 12 years, and translate to roughly $417 per year of value. Custom cabinets run $500–$1,400+ per foot, endure 30 + years, and cost $667 per year, yet they boost resale price 10–15 %. In a 10×10 kitchen, a $5,600 stock install yields modest returns, while a $20,000+ custom fit can recoup a sizable portion of the outlay. Data shows luxury markets expect custom; stock signals cut corners, reducing buyer willingness to pay premium offers. Higher durability also contributes to lower long‑term maintenance costs. Which Built‑In Storage Solutions Boost Home Value (Cabinet ROI)?
If you prioritize ROI, focus on built‑in storage that combines high utility with premium perception—like deep pantry drawers, pull‑out spice racks, and integrated appliance garages. Market data shows that buyers assign a 4‑6 % price premium to homes with customized storage, especially when the solutions are visible and functional. Install tall, adjustable shelving in the kitchen and add LED shelf lighting to highlight organization and increase perceived cleanliness. In the mudroom, incorporate a built‑in coat rack and a lockable compartment for seasonal gear; this boosts resale appeal without expanding square footage. For garage organization, embed recessed cabinets with pull‑out trays and dedicated tool slots, then finish with under‑cabinet lighting to showcase the tidy space. 2024 Cost‑To‑Value Ratios for Cabinet Upgrades
Four distinct cost‑to‑value ratios illustrate how different cabinet upgrades impact your home’s resale potential. A minor kitchen remodel—average $26,672—delivers 94.3% ROI, climbing to 112.9% in 2026, because it focuses on cabinet ergonomics and material sustainability without breaching major remodel thresholds. Refacing costs $4,000‑$9,000 and yields 60‑75% ROI, yet premium refacing on sound structures can reach 90‑100% ROI while preserving existing boxes and improving front aesthetics. Midrange remodels at $76,798 capture 51.9% ROI, with strategic durable‑cabinet choices recouping 70‑80% of spend. Upscale projects spend $149,462 but only see 39.1% ROI, as luxury finishes underperform efficiency upgrades. Allocate 30‑40% of your budget to cabinets for peak returns. Which Cabinet Choices Maximize ROI?
When you prioritize ROI, the data show that soft‑close hardware, shaker‑style doors, and cabinet refacing consistently outpace other upgrades. Soft‑close hardware delivers roughly 100 % ROI at $150‑$300, eliminates slamming, and signals premium quality to buyers. Shaker‑style doors capture 61 % buyer preference and generate 70‑80 % ROI, bridging classic and modern aesthetics for broad market appeal. Cabinet refacing recoups over 80 % of costs, yielding a 96.1 % ROI while providing a move‑in‑ready look at a fraction of full replacement expense. For added perceived value, install pull‑out organizers with hidden compartments; they cost $80‑$250 each and add $1,000‑$3,000 in perceived value, achieving 70‑90 % ROI.
